dmv.ca.gov. The California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) is the state agency that registers motor vehicles and boats and issues driver licenses in the U.S. state of California.

Who created the term DMV?
By 1905, it became clear that California should issue a state-wide vehicle registration system, so the task was referred to the Secretary of State (SOS). The SOS handled vehicle registrations from 1905 until 1915, at which time Senator E. Birdsall enacted the official Vehicle Act of 1915 and created an official DMV.
Why is DC called the DMV?
The National Capital Region portion of the Washington Metropolitan Area is also colloquially known by the acronym “DMV” which stands for the “District of Columbia, Maryland, Virginia.” The area in the region that is surrounded by Interstate 495 referred to as being “Inside the Beltway”.
What is a real ID Michigan?
The REAL ID ACT is the post-9/11 federal requirement that sets higher security protocols for the production of driver’s licenses and state ID cards, including the use of features to prevent illegal copying or altering.
How much is a drivers license in Michigan?
The fees for getting your standard Michigan driver’s license vary. An original license costs $25. A renewal license costs $18. There is a $7 late renewal fee if you renew your license after it expired.

Are all the states DMV connected?
Reciprocity: The Driver License Compact
Thanks to the Driver License Compact (DLC), your driving record will follow you almost anywhere you go in the United States. The DLC is an interstate agreement that facilitates states’ exchange of information regarding traffic violations, suspensions, and revocations.
Is a Real ID a driver’s license?
A REAL ID is a driver’s license or identification card that is also a federally accepted form of identification. It can be used to board a domestic flight within the U.S. and enter secure federal facilities, such as military bases, federal courthouses, and other secure federal locations.
How many Dmvs are in California?
The California DMV has near 180 field office locations throughout California and is the largest DMV system in the US.
What does the California DMV do?
DMV Functions
Maintain driving records (accidents and convictions) of licensed drivers. Issue identification cards for individuals. Register and record ownership of vessels. License and regulate driving and traffic violator schools and their instructors.

Can I still fly without a REAL ID?
Starting May 3, 2023, every traveler will need to present a REAL ID-compliant license or an acceptable form of identification to fly within the U.S. Passengers who do not present an acceptable form of identification will not be permitted through the security checkpoint.
What does the gold star on Michigan license mean?
A REAL ID-compliant driver’s license or state ID card will have a star in a gold circle printed in the upper right corner of the card. Enhanced licenses and state ID cards that do not have a star on them are still REAL ID compliant and will be printed with a star when renewed or replaced.
What do I need to get my license in Michigan?
Present documentation of a valid Social Security number or letter of ineligibility, U.S. citizenship or legal presence if not a U.S. citizen, identity and Michigan residency. Take a vision test and pass the physical standards. Have your photograph taken. Pay a $25 fee and obtain a Temporary Operator’s Permit.

What states are in the DLC?
The Driver License compact is an interstate compact among 45 states and the District of Columbia. Georgia, Massachusetts, Michigan, Tennessee, and Wisconsin are the only states that are not members.

Can I get a license in Florida if suspended in another state?
Driving Is a Privilege
If you move to Florida from another state where your license is suspended, Florida requires you to clear up the suspension in that state before they will allow you to obtain a new license in Florida. You have 30 days after you become a resident of the state to obtain a Florida driver’s license.
Can I get a license in Texas if suspended in another state?
Suspension in a Different State or Jurisdiction
If your driver license status is suspended, revoked, denied, or cancelled in another state, you are not eligible to apply for Texas driver license.

Can I drive into Canada with a REAL ID?
No. REAL ID cards cannot be used for border crossings into Canada, Mexico or other international travel.
Is DMV a government agency?
A department of motor vehicles (DMV) is a government agency that administers motor vehicle registration and driver licensing.

Is DMV CA Gov legit?
The DMV advised Californians to only use the DMV’s official website, www.dmv.ca.gov, and said that there are “no additional fees to complete the electronic application or any online services.” DMV investigators are looking into the private sites to see if they are breaking any consumer protection laws.
Can I drive if I lost my license California?
Can I Drive if I Lost My License in California? According to California Vehicle Code Section §12500, “A person may not drive a motor vehicle upon a highway, unless the person then holds a valid driver’s license issued under this code, except those persons who are expressly exempted under this code.”
How much is a real ID?
Normal driver’s license and ID card fees apply. There is no additional cost for a REAL ID-compliant license or ID card when a person renews normally.
How much is a California real ID?
The DMV has posted a list of documents that Real ID applicants may use. Typically, the cost is the same as for a regular California driver’s license, $38. The cost is $33 for state ID cards.
